Satellites watch Francine make landfall as a Category 2 hurricane in Louisiana (video)
Hurricane Francine, the sixth storm of this year’s Atlantic hurricane season, made landfall on the Louisiana coast late afternoon on Wednesday.
Hurricane Francine, the sixth storm of this year’s Atlantic hurricane season, made landfall on the Louisiana coast late afternoon on Wednesday.